我必须为学校编写这个程序,将一对二维数组相乘。当我尝试运行程序时,我不断收到越界:3错误。

我已经多次检查了代码,并且一生都无法弄清楚故障发生在哪里。我运行了一个调试,第一个断点位于 if 语句"if (a[0].length != b.length)",我不知道为什么这是一个断点。

有人可以帮助我吗?

    public class Multiply {
    public static double[][] Multiply_2D_Arrays(double[][] a, double[][] b)
    { 
        if (a[0].length != b.length) // Check to see if the number of a's colums equals the number of b's rows
        {
            throw new IllegalArgumentException("Matrices don't match: " + a[0].length + " != " + b.length);
        }
        int a_rows = a.length;      // Defines the variable M as the row length of array a
        int b_columns = b[0].length;   // Defines the variable N as the column length of array b
        double[][] c = new double[a_rows][b_columns]; // This means that the dimensions of array c will be the rows of a by the columns of b
        for(int i = 0; i < a.length; i++)
            {
                for(int j = 0; j < b[0].length; j++)
                {
                    for(int k = 0; k < a[0].length; )
                    {
                        c[i][j] += a[i][k] * b[k][j];     //Iterates through each row and column of array a and b and then adding it to the dot point sum
                    }
                }
            }
            return c;      //returns the final new array c
        }
    public static void main(String[] args)
    {
        double[][] array1 = {{4.0, 5.0, 6.0}, {2.0, 1.0, 4.0}, {8.0, 7.0, 6.0}, {1.0, 1.0, 2.0}};
        double[][] array2 = {{5.0, 7.0, 7.0, 8.0}, {8.0, 8.0, 9.0, 2.0}, {10.0, 2.0, 3.0, 1.0}};
        double[][] array3 = Multiply.Multiply_2D_Arrays(array1, array2); //Calls the Multiply_2D_Arrays method
        for(int i = 0; i < array3.length; i++)
        {
            for (int j = 0; j < array3.length; j++)
            {
                System.out.print(array3[i][j] + " ");
            }
        }
        System.out.println();
    }
}

你错过了k++ for(int k = 0; k < a[0].length; )

然后你有一个无限循环

另外,如果要将结果打印为矩阵,请将System.out.println()放入 for 循环中:

    for(int i = 0; i < array3.length; i++)
    {
        for (int j = 0; j < array3.length; j++)
        {
            System.out.print(array3[i][j] + " ");
        }
        System.out.println();
    }

如果您将此for(int k = 0; k < a[0].length; )更改为for(int k = 0; k < a[0].length;k++ )错过了 for 循环中的k++,程序将正确执行。
